Teams in production are under a lot of pressure since there is always a need to produce quality launches on schedule. To match the evolving standards, the QA teams have to follow specifications for coding and its implementation since errors aren’t a choice anymore.
That’s why development teams use static analysis tools. Here, we present everything about static code analysis.
Best Static Code Analysis Tool and How To Choose The Right One
There are tons of tools available in the market today. It is very difficult to pick the best one, but there are some qualities that you can check if what you are picking suits your needs.
Matching Your Requirements
Complying with specifications is the main application of static analysis tools. So, when you are in a competitive industry needing a coding standard, you’ll want to make absolutely sure your tool supports the standard.
Language of Programming
For multiple programming languages, tools make it easy. So, choosing a tool that matches your languages is essential.
You can consider these points when you are looking for the right tool. However, it is better to understand the basics of static code analysis first.
What is Static Analysis?
By dynamically inspecting a source code before a program runs, static analysis is better defined as a form of debugging.
What Are the Benefits of Static Analysis Tools?
Static analysis tools cover a vast range of tools that inspect source code, executable files, or even documents in order to identify issues that may occur.
At the exact spot, it will discover vulnerabilities in the code. Skilled software assurance developers who fully understand the code can conduct the source code tests using these tools. For fixes, it allows a faster turnaround. It is relatively quick if these tools are automatic.
Which Factors Should You Consider While Selecting a Code Review Tool?
- The tool you are using must recognize your language, but it is not a key factor when it supports.
- Vulnerabilities that it can find
- Will it need an entirely constructive source set?
- Will it work instead of the source against binaries?
- Can it be incorporated into the IDE of the developer?
- Cost of a licence for the tool. (Most are offered per customer, per organization, per application, per analyzed a piece of code).
Best Static Code Analysis Software
With the most comprehensive database for the Salesforce platform, our team recommends CodeScan.co as a best salesforce static code analysis software.
As per quality standards, CodeScan preserves the consistency of your code.
It implements the coding principles and minimises the complexity of code in growth.
To enhance your code quality and performance, the CodeScan software helps to track your technological debt.
Anyone can try it as it is codeless, you don’t need any expertise.